GUI टूलकिट

From binaryoption
Jump to navigation Jump to search
Баннер1
    1. जीयूआई टूलकिट: शुरुआती के लिए विस्तृत गाइड

जीयूआई (GUI) टूलकिट एक सॉफ्टवेयर डेवलपमेंट का महत्वपूर्ण हिस्सा है जो डेवलपर्स को ग्राफिकल यूजर इंटरफेस (Graphical User Interface) बनाने की अनुमति देता है। ये टूलकिट पूर्व-निर्मित घटकों (components) और उपकरणों (tools) का एक संग्रह प्रदान करते हैं जिनका उपयोग एप्लिकेशन के दृश्य भाग को डिजाइन और कार्यान्वित करने के लिए किया जा सकता है। बाइनरी ऑप्शन ट्रेडिंग प्लेटफॉर्म भी जीयूआई टूलकिट का उपयोग करके बनाए जाते हैं, और एक मजबूत जीयूआई समग्र ट्रेडिंग अनुभव को काफी हद तक प्रभावित कर सकता है। इस लेख में, हम जीयूआई टूलकिट की मूल अवधारणाओं, विभिन्न प्रकारों, प्रमुख विशेषताओं और बाइनरी ऑप्शन ट्रेडिंग में उनके महत्व पर गहराई से विचार करेंगे।

जीयूआई टूलकिट क्या है?

जीयूआई टूलकिट (GUI Toolkit), जिसे जीयूआई लाइब्रेरी (GUI Library) या जीयूआई फ्रेमवर्क (GUI Framework) के रूप में भी जाना जाता है, सॉफ्टवेयर घटकों का एक सेट है जो डेवलपर्स को ग्राफिकल यूजर इंटरफेस (जीयूआई) बनाने में मदद करता है। जीयूआई, उपयोगकर्ता और कंप्यूटर सिस्टम के बीच एक दृश्य माध्यम प्रदान करता है, जिससे उपयोगकर्ता आइकन, मेनू और विंडो जैसे तत्वों के माध्यम से एप्लिकेशन के साथ इंटरैक्ट कर सकते हैं।

एक जीयूआई टूलकिट में आमतौर पर निम्नलिखित तत्व शामिल होते हैं:

  • **विजेट (Widgets):** ये जीयूआई के मूलभूत निर्माण खंड हैं, जैसे बटन, लेबल, टेक्स्ट बॉक्स, और सूची।
  • **लेआउट मैनेजर (Layout Managers):** ये विजेट को स्क्रीन पर व्यवस्थित करने के लिए उपयोग किए जाते हैं।
  • **इवेंट हैंडलर (Event Handlers):** ये उपयोगकर्ता इंटरैक्शन, जैसे माउस क्लिक और कीबोर्ड प्रेस को संभालने के लिए उपयोग किए जाते हैं।
  • **ग्राफिक्स इंजन (Graphics Engine):** ये स्क्रीन पर ग्राफिक्स को रेंडर करने के लिए उपयोग किए जाते हैं।

जीयूआई टूलकिट के प्रकार

विभिन्न प्रकार के जीयूआई टूलकिट उपलब्ध हैं, प्रत्येक की अपनी विशेषताएं और फायदे हैं। यहां कुछ सबसे लोकप्रिय जीयूआई टूलकिट दिए गए हैं:

  • **Qt:** एक क्रॉस-प्लेटफ़ॉर्म एप्लिकेशन फ्रेमवर्क जो सी++ में लिखा गया है। यह अपनी व्यापक सुविधाओं, प्रदर्शन और अनुकूलन क्षमता के लिए जाना जाता है। Qt फ्रेमवर्क
  • **GTK:** एक क्रॉस-प्लेटफ़ॉर्म टूलकिट जो सी में लिखा गया है। यह अपने लचीलेपन, विस्तारशीलता और जीएनओएमई डेस्कटॉप वातावरण के साथ एकीकरण के लिए जाना जाता है। GTK+ टूलकिट
  • **wxWidgets:** एक क्रॉस-प्लेटफ़ॉर्म टूलकिट जो सी++ में लिखा गया है। यह अपने मूल लुक और फील और विभिन्न प्लेटफ़ॉर्मों पर संगतता के लिए जाना जाता है। wxWidgets लाइब्रेरी
  • **Tkinter:** पायथन के लिए मानक जीयूआई टूलकिट। यह सीखना आसान है और छोटे से मध्यम आकार के अनुप्रयोगों के लिए उपयुक्त है। Tkinter दस्तावेज़ीकरण
  • **JavaFX:** जावा के लिए एक जीयूआई टूलकिट। यह अपने समृद्ध सुविधाओं, आधुनिक लुक और जावा इकोसिस्टम के साथ एकीकरण के लिए जाना जाता है। JavaFX अवलोकन
  • **Electron:** एक फ्रेमवर्क जिसका उपयोग वेब तकनीकों (एचटीएमएल, सीएसएस, जावास्क्रिप्ट) का उपयोग करके क्रॉस-प्लेटफ़ॉर्म डेस्कटॉप एप्लिकेशन बनाने के लिए किया जाता है। Electron फ्रेमवर्क

जीयूआई टूलकिट की प्रमुख विशेषताएं

एक अच्छा जीयूआई टूलकिट निम्नलिखित प्रमुख विशेषताओं को प्रदान करता है:

  • **क्रॉस-प्लेटफ़ॉर्म संगतता:** टूलकिट को विभिन्न ऑपरेटिंग सिस्टम (जैसे विंडोज, मैकओएस, लिनक्स) पर काम करने में सक्षम होना चाहिए। यह डेवलपर्स को एक ही कोडबेस से कई प्लेटफ़ॉर्म के लिए एप्लिकेशन बनाने की अनुमति देता है।
  • **विजेट की विस्तृत श्रृंखला:** टूलकिट को विभिन्न प्रकार के विजेट प्रदान करने चाहिए ताकि डेवलपर्स विभिन्न प्रकार के जीयूआई तत्वों को बना सकें।
  • **लेआउट प्रबंधन:** टूलकिट को विजेट को स्क्रीन पर व्यवस्थित करने के लिए लचीले और शक्तिशाली लेआउट प्रबंधन उपकरण प्रदान करने चाहिए।
  • **इवेंट हैंडलिंग:** टूलकिट को उपयोगकर्ता इंटरैक्शन को संभालने के लिए एक सरल और कुशल इवेंट हैंडलिंग तंत्र प्रदान करना चाहिए।
  • **कस्टम विजेट निर्माण:** टूलकिट को डेवलपर्स को अपनी आवश्यकताओं के अनुसार कस्टम विजेट बनाने की अनुमति देनी चाहिए।
  • **दस्तावेज़ीकरण और समर्थन:** टूलकिट को व्यापक दस्तावेज़ीकरण और सक्रिय समुदाय समर्थन प्रदान करना चाहिए।

बाइनरी ऑप्शन ट्रेडिंग में जीयूआई टूलकिट का महत्व

बाइनरी ऑप्शन ट्रेडिंग प्लेटफॉर्म में जीयूआई टूलकिट एक महत्वपूर्ण भूमिका निभाता है। एक अच्छी तरह से डिज़ाइन किया गया जीयूआई ट्रेडिंग अनुभव को काफी हद तक प्रभावित कर सकता है। यहां कुछ तरीके दिए गए हैं जिनसे जीयूआई टूलकिट बाइनरी ऑप्शन ट्रेडिंग में महत्वपूर्ण है:

  • **चार्टिंग:** जीयूआई टूलकिट का उपयोग विभिन्न प्रकार के चार्ट (जैसे लाइन चार्ट, बार चार्ट, कैंडलस्टिक चार्ट) प्रदर्शित करने के लिए किया जाता है जो व्यापारियों को बाजार के रुझानों का विश्लेषण करने में मदद करते हैं। तकनीकी विश्लेषण
  • **ऑर्डर एंट्री:** जीयूआई टूलकिट का उपयोग ऑर्डर एंट्री फॉर्म बनाने के लिए किया जाता है जो व्यापारियों को जल्दी और आसानी से ट्रेड दर्ज करने की अनुमति देता है। ऑर्डर प्रकार
  • **खाता प्रबंधन:** जीयूआई टूलकिट का उपयोग खाता प्रबंधन इंटरफेस बनाने के लिए किया जाता है जो व्यापारियों को अपने खाते की जानकारी देखने और प्रबंधित करने की अनुमति देता है। खाता प्रबंधन रणनीतियाँ
  • **वास्तविक समय डेटा प्रदर्शन:** जीयूआई टूलकिट का उपयोग वास्तविक समय बाजार डेटा प्रदर्शित करने के लिए किया जाता है, जैसे कि मूल्य उद्धरण, वॉल्यूम और अन्य महत्वपूर्ण जानकारी। वॉल्यूम विश्लेषण
  • **संकेतक और उपकरण:** जीयूआई टूलकिट का उपयोग तकनीकी संकेतकों (जैसे मूविंग एवरेज, आरएसआई, एमएसीडी) और अन्य ट्रेडिंग उपकरणों को प्रदर्शित करने के लिए किया जाता है जो व्यापारियों को ट्रेडिंग निर्णय लेने में मदद करते हैं। तकनीकी संकेतक

एक प्रभावी जीयूआई बाइनरी ऑप्शन ट्रेडिंग प्लेटफॉर्म की सफलता के लिए आवश्यक है। यह सुनिश्चित करता है कि व्यापारी आसानी से जानकारी प्राप्त कर सकें, ट्रेड दर्ज कर सकें और अपने खाते को प्रबंधित कर सकें।

लोकप्रिय बाइनरी ऑप्शन ट्रेडिंग प्लेटफॉर्म और उनके जीयूआई टूलकिट

कई बाइनरी ऑप्शन ट्रेडिंग प्लेटफॉर्म विभिन्न जीयूआई टूलकिट का उपयोग करते हैं। यहां कुछ उदाहरण दिए गए हैं:

  • **SpotOption:** यह प्लेटफॉर्म अक्सर वेब-आधारित तकनीकों जैसे HTML5, CSS3, और जावास्क्रिप्ट का उपयोग करता है, जो प्रभावी रूप से एक कस्टम जीयूआई टूलकिट के रूप में कार्य करते हैं।
  • **TechFinancials:** यह प्लेटफॉर्म अपने प्लेटफॉर्म के लिए कस्टम जीयूआई समाधान विकसित करता है, जो अक्सर सी++ और जावा जैसी भाषाओं का उपयोग करते हैं।
  • **AnyOption:** यह प्लेटफॉर्म भी वेब-आधारित तकनीकों का उपयोग करता है और एक अनुकूलित जीयूआई प्रदान करता है।

ये प्लेटफॉर्म अपने जीयूआई को लगातार अपडेट और बेहतर बनाते रहते हैं ताकि व्यापारियों को सर्वोत्तम संभव अनुभव प्रदान किया जा सके।

जीयूआई टूलकिट का चयन कैसे करें?

एक जीयूआई टूलकिट का चयन करते समय, निम्नलिखित कारकों पर विचार करना महत्वपूर्ण है:

  • **प्लेटफ़ॉर्म संगतता:** टूलकिट को आपके लक्षित प्लेटफ़ॉर्म (जैसे विंडोज, मैकओएस, लिनक्स) के साथ संगत होना चाहिए।
  • **भाषा समर्थन:** टूलकिट को आपकी पसंदीदा प्रोग्रामिंग भाषा (जैसे सी++, सी, पायथन, जावा) का समर्थन करना चाहिए।
  • **लाइसेंसिंग:** टूलकिट के लाइसेंसिंग शर्तों पर ध्यान दें। कुछ टूलकिट मुफ्त और ओपन-सोर्स हैं, जबकि अन्य को लाइसेंस शुल्क की आवश्यकता होती है।
  • **समुदाय समर्थन:** टूलकिट के लिए एक सक्रिय समुदाय होना महत्वपूर्ण है ताकि आप आवश्यक सहायता प्राप्त कर सकें।
  • **सीखने की अवस्था:** टूलकिट को सीखना आसान होना चाहिए, खासकर यदि आप शुरुआती हैं।

जीयूआई डेवलपमेंट के लिए सर्वोत्तम अभ्यास

एक प्रभावी जीयूआई विकसित करने के लिए, निम्नलिखित सर्वोत्तम अभ्यासों का पालन करना महत्वपूर्ण है:

  • **उपयोगकर्ता केंद्रित डिजाइन:** जीयूआई को उपयोगकर्ताओं की आवश्यकताओं और अपेक्षाओं को ध्यान में रखकर डिजाइन करें।
  • **सरलता:** जीयूआई को सरल और सहज रखें। अनावश्यक तत्वों से बचें।
  • **संगति:** जीयूआई में सभी तत्वों को समान रूप से डिजाइन करें।
  • **प्रतिक्रिया:** उपयोगकर्ताओं को उनकी क्रियाओं के लिए त्वरित प्रतिक्रिया प्रदान करें।
  • **पहुंच:** जीयूआई को विकलांग उपयोगकर्ताओं के लिए सुलभ बनाएं। पहुंचनीयता दिशानिर्देश
  • **परीक्षण:** जीयूआई का व्यापक रूप से परीक्षण करें ताकि यह सुनिश्चित हो सके कि यह सही ढंग से काम करता है और उपयोगकर्ता के अनुकूल है।

निष्कर्ष

जीयूआई टूलकिट सॉफ्टवेयर डेवलपमेंट का एक महत्वपूर्ण हिस्सा है जो डेवलपर्स को ग्राफिकल यूजर इंटरफेस बनाने की अनुमति देता है। बाइनरी ऑप्शन ट्रेडिंग प्लेटफॉर्म में जीयूआई टूलकिट एक महत्वपूर्ण भूमिका निभाता है, और एक अच्छी तरह से डिज़ाइन किया गया जीयूआई ट्रेडिंग अनुभव को काफी हद तक प्रभावित कर सकता है। सही जीयूआई टूलकिट का चयन करके और सर्वोत्तम अभ्यासों का पालन करके, आप एक प्रभावी और उपयोगकर्ता के अनुकूल जीयूआई विकसित कर सकते हैं जो आपके बाइनरी ऑप्शन ट्रेडिंग प्लेटफॉर्म की सफलता में योगदान देगा। जोखिम प्रबंधन पैसे का प्रबंधन ट्रेडिंग मनोविज्ञान बाइनरी ऑप्शन रणनीतियाँ बाजार का विश्लेषण

अभी ट्रेडिंग शुरू करें

IQ Option पर रजिस्टर करें (न्यूनतम जमा $10) Pocket Option में खाता खोलें (न्यूनतम जमा $5)

हमारे समुदाय में शामिल हों

हमारे Telegram चैनल @strategybin से जुड़ें और प्राप्त करें: ✓ दैनिक ट्रेडिंग सिग्नल ✓ विशेष रणनीति विश्लेषण ✓ बाजार की प्रवृत्ति पर अलर्ट ✓ शुरुआती के लिए शिक्षण सामग्री

Баннер